Victor 16073 (Black label (popular) 10-in. double-faced)

The following matrix(es) were released with this catalog number:

CompanyMatrix No.Take NumberDateTitle/Artist 
Victor B-6429 2 9/21/1908 Southern beauties / Arthur Pryor's Band
Victor B-6433 2 9/21/1908 Dainty Dollie / Arthur Pryor's Band

Primary Performers:

Arthur Pryor's Band (Musical group)

Other Information:

Release Date: 11/1908 Source: Victor blue history card
Delete (Cutout) Date: 11/1913

Note: Export delete: 3-1914
